Inadequate Flashing Setup



Selecting the right materials isn't the only factor that can lead to roofing troubles; poor flashing setup can additionally produce significant issues. Flashing is crucial for guiding water far from prone locations, such as smokeshafts, skylights, and roofing valleys. If it's not mounted correctly, you run the risk of water intrusion, which can bring about mold and mildew growth and structural damage.

When you set up blinking, ensure it's the ideal type for your roofing's style and the local climate. For instance, metal flashing is frequently extra sturdy than plastic in areas with heavy rainfall or snow. See to it the flashing overlaps properly and is secured snugly to stop gaps where water can permeate via.

You should additionally focus on the setup angle. Blinking must be placed to guide water away from your house, not toward it.

If you're unsure regarding the installation process or the materials required, speak with an expert. They can help determine the best blinking choices and make sure everything is set up appropriately, securing your home from prospective water damages.

Neglecting Air Flow Requirements



While numerous property owners focus on the visual and structural facets of roof covering setup, overlooking ventilation requirements can cause serious long-term repercussions. Appropriate air flow is important for regulating temperature and moisture degrees in your attic, protecting against problems like mold growth, wood rot, and ice dams. If you do not install appropriate air flow, you're establishing your roofing up for failing.

To avoid this mistake, first, assess your home's specific air flow needs. A well balanced system commonly consists of both intake and exhaust vents to advertise airflow. Guarantee you have actually installed soffit vents along the eaves and ridge vents at the top of your roof covering. This mix allows hot air to run away while cooler air enters, maintaining your attic area comfy.

Also, consider the type of roof product you have actually selected. Some materials might need added ventilation techniques. Ascertain your regional building codes for air flow standards, as they can differ dramatically.

Ultimately, don't fail to remember to examine your air flow system on a regular basis. Clogs from debris or insulation can impede air flow, so maintain those vents clear.
